The chemical substance known as a-D-Glucopyranoside, phenylmethyl O-6-deoxy-2,3,4-tris-O-(phenylmethyl)-a-L-galactopyranosyl-(1→3)-O-[b-D-galactopyranosyl-(1→4)]-2-(acetylamino)-2-deoxy-6-O-(phenylmethyl)- (9CI), with the CAS number 71208-05-4, is a complex glycoside. This compound features multiple sugar units, including glucopyranose and galactopyranose, linked through glycosidic bonds, which contribute to its structural complexity and potential biological activity. The presence of phenylmethyl groups enhances its hydrophobic characteristics, potentially influencing its solubility and interaction with biological membranes. The acetylamino group suggests that the compound may participate in various biochemical processes, possibly acting as a substrate or inhibitor in enzymatic reactions. Its intricate structure may also confer specific properties, such as stability and reactivity, making it of interest in fields like medicinal chemistry and biochemistry. Overall, this compound exemplifies the diversity of glycosides and their potential applications in research and industry.
